Where it lives
All of the above is stored on your device, in Otis’ local database. Nothing leaves your phone unless you explicitly opt in to iCloud sync. When that ships, your records sync to your private iCloud account — Apple holds the keys, Otis never sees them.
What we send to our servers
Otis is backed by a small Cloudflare Worker at api.otis.money. When you pull-to-refresh or search for a ticker, we send:
- The ticker symbols you’re asking about.
- Your home currency (for FX conversion).
- An anonymous device identifier, used to apply rate limits and prevent abuse.
That’s the entire payload. We never send your transactions, your portfolio sizes, your name, or anything that identifies you personally.
Third parties
The Worker proxies your queries to:
- CoinGecko — crypto prices.
- European Central Bank — daily FX reference rates.
- Polygon.io — US stock prices.
- EODHD — JSE prices and dividend calendars.
Those services see ticker symbols. They don’t see who you are, what you own, or how much.
